Meridian Posted August 3, 2019 Report Share Posted August 3, 2019 GPA always matters. You need the GPA to go to full file review. If you are eligible for weighted wGPA, they use that instead of cGPA. You can use an academic explanation essay to explain a gap or an irregularity. Adcom may then decide to use a variation of wGPA where you normally would not be eligible. They wont just forgo the GPA minimums due to extenuating circumstances.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
